Is Wegovy covered by insurance?

Coverage varies widely by plan; without coverage, many patients compare it to compounded semaglutide, which is far cheaper.

Does Wegovy work better than Ozempic for weight loss?

It is the same molecule (semaglutide), but Wegovy goes up to 2.4 mg/week versus 2.0 mg max for Ozempic - a dose built for weight loss, which is why it is approved for that indication.

Who can prescribe this treatment?

A physician or authorized practitioner (depending on the state) after evaluation; in telehealth, that practitioner must be licensed in the patient's state of residence.
